The Therapy Services Specialist Sr. is responsible for working directly to support new and current specialist. How you will make an impact: Work with the lead case manager on state specific processes and policies and ensure that state specific standard operating procedures are up to date. May partner with leadership and assists in leading procedure and process updates. Performs telephonic and/or virtual assessments to identify participants needs on more complex cases. Support leads in overseeing recommendations to MCO for type and hours of supportive services required. Support process to conduct objective assessments for program participation to determine the appropriate level of support and services required. Support lead in the overseeing the assessments annually or more frequently as needed in accordance with applicable program requirements and participants needs. Assists with case consults. Mentor and provide shadowing opportunities during new hire orientation or on an ongoing basis. May serve as the back up to lead associates. Assists leads with CFER reviews.
